20-year-old Nigerian arrested for human trafficking

A 20-year-old Nigerian, Favour Chidi, has been arrested by the Tema Regional Command of the Ghana Immigration Service (GIS) for allegedly trafficking two Nigerian girls into Ghana to engage in prostitution.

The suspect, is believed to be part of a human trafficking syndicate that brings Nigerian girls into Ghana to take part in the sex trade.

She was however arrested when she attempted to smuggle the girls into the country at the Western North Region border.
